About Skellefteå Kraft
Skellefteå Kraft is a company based in Skelleftea (Sweden) founded in 1906. It operates as a Subscription Services, and Direct-to-Consumer (D2C). Skellefteå Kraft offers products and services including Electricity Contracts, District Heating, Fiber Broadband, EV Charging Solutions, and Solar Panels. Skellefteå Kraft operates in a competitive market with competitors including Acciona Energy, Vasa Vind, Svevind, Slitevind and Power Wind Partners, among others.

Where is Skellefteå Kraft located?
Skellefteå Kraft is headquartered in Skelleftea, Sweden. It is registered at Skelleftea, Vasterbotten, Sweden.
What does Skellefteå Kraft do?
Skellefteå Kraft is involved in the distribution of electricity, district heating, and fiber broadband services. The company operates primarily in the renewable energy sector, offering solutions such as electricity contracts with 100 renewable energy, solar panel installations, and electric vehicle charging infrastructure. Services are extended to both private and corporate customers in Sweden, with a focus on sustainability and energy efficiency. Additionally, innovative projects are undertaken to support a fully renewable energy system.
